Tragic Crash Claims Lives of Three Promising Football Stars
A tragic incident unfolded in Upper Marlboro, Maryland, where a devastating car crash took the lives of Minnesota Vikings rookie cornerback Khyree Jackson and two of his former high school teammates. The event has sent shockwaves through the football community and beyond, as authorities have indicted Cori Clingman on multiple charges, including vehicular manslaughter related to driving under the influence.

Seeking Justice for Fallen Heroes: A Community United in Grief and Resolve

The Incident: A Night That Changed Everything

In the early hours of July 6, a three-car collision on a quiet stretch of road in Upper Marlboro claimed the lives of three young men with bright futures ahead of them. Khyree Jackson, Isaiah Hazel, and Anthony Lytton Jr., all former teammates from Dr. Henry A. Wise Jr. High School, were traveling together just after 3 a.m. when their vehicle was struck by another car that was speeding and changing lanes recklessly. According to State’s Attorney Aisha Braveboy, evidence suggests that contact was made between Cori Clingman's vehicle and the victims' car, causing it to veer off the road and collide with tree stumps. Tragically, Jackson and Hazel died at the scene, while Lytton succumbed to his injuries at the hospital.The impact of this accident extends far beyond the immediate families. These three young men were not only talented athletes but also pillars of their community. They had shared a remarkable journey, winning a state championship together at their high school. Hazel had played college football at Maryland and Charlotte, while Lytton had showcased his skills at Florida State and Penn State. Jackson, a fourth-round draft pick by the Vikings, had already made waves in the football world, playing two years at Alabama before finishing his college career at Oregon. Their untimely deaths left an indelible mark on everyone who knew them.

Pursuing Accountability: The Legal Battle Begins

Cori Clingman now faces a daunting legal battle, charged with 13 counts, including vehicular manslaughter and driving under the influence. If convicted, she could face up to 30 years in prison. Braveboy emphasized that this indictment marks the beginning of a long fight for justice. The families of the victims, along with the broader community, are united in their pursuit of accountability. Braveboy stated, "This just starts really our fight to get justice for these three young men, their families, Wise High School, the NFL, and this entire community."The arrest of Clingman was carried out without incident, and she is scheduled for a bond review. It remains unclear whether Clingman has legal representation. Legacy and Impact: Remembering the Stars

The legacy of Jackson, Hazel, and Lytton transcends the football field. They were more than just athletes; they were role models and leaders in their community. Their achievements on the field were matched by their character off it. The loss of these three individuals has left a void that cannot easily be filled. Schools, teams, and communities across the country have rallied to honor their memory, organizing memorials and tributes that celebrate their lives and accomplishments.The Minnesota Vikings, along with the NFL, have expressed their condolences and support for the families. The league has a responsibility to ensure that such tragedies do not go unnoticed and that steps are taken to prevent similar incidents in the future. The NFL has launched initiatives aimed at promoting safe driving and raising awareness about the risks associated with impaired driving. In this way, the memory of Jackson, Hazel, and Lytton can inspire positive change and leave a lasting impact on future generations.
